If you have a vintage fuzz or wah, or any pedal that doesn’t like being after a buffer you can use the passive input first. It’s important to return to the buffered input if you want to take advantage of the always-on tuner send. TUNER STEREO WET PEDALS (modulation, delay...

The Interfacer features DMS™ which stands for Dual Mode Summing. Unique circuitry, designed by Goodwood Audio, that provides two types of summing, Stereo Sum and Split Sum. The default setting is Stereo Sum.

L output will stay active, but the R output will have no signal. Ground Lift & Phase Correction (The TX Interfacer only) The TX Interfacer features red and black push buttons. Press the red button to lift ground of the right output. Press the black button to invert the phase of the right output by 180°...

Specs Power: 2.1mm barrel, centre negative, 9vDC power only! Minimum 100mA Dimensions (incl. all jacks and switches): 73mm wide x 115mm deep x 68mm high Weight: The Interfacer – 315 grams The TX Interfacer – 325 grams @goodwoodaudio info@goodwoodaudio.com...
